IFC considers investment in TLcom fund
The IFC is considering an equity investment of up to $10 million in the TIDE II fund, an Africa-focused venture capital fund investing in seed to series A tech and tech-enabled companies mainly in East and West Africa.
The fund’s sectoral focus will mainly be in the fintech, e-logistics, e-supply chain and healthtech space.
TIDE II is managed by TLcom Holdings, a United Kingdom-based entity wholly owned by TLcom Capital LLP.
